Abstract

Systems, assemblies, and methods are provided herein for fastening of one bone to another bone using one or more sutures. The features herein enable such fastening with a more accurate strength, and which can be more easily fastened in-situ.

Claims (19)

1 . A suture-button system comprising:

(a) a plurality of suture strands;

(b) a primary button having a plurality of primary apertures, wherein:

(i) a first suture strand of the plurality of suture strands is inserted through a first set of primary apertures of the plurality of primary apertures;

(ii) a second suture strand of the plurality of suture strands is inserted through a second set of primary apertures of the plurality of primary apertures;

(iii) the plurality of primary apertures comprises at least eight primary apertures;

(iv) the first set of primary apertures is different from the second set of primary apertures;

(v) the first set of primary apertures are equally spaced relative to each other in a least a partially circular array; and

(vi) one or both of the first suture strand and the second suture strand is inserted through the respective first set of primary apertures and second set of primary apertures in a weaving configuration; and

(c) a secondary button having a plurality of secondary apertures, wherein:

(i) the first suture strand and the second suture strand are each inserted through a first and second secondary aperture of the plurality of secondary apertures, wherein the suture-button system is configured to clamp at least one targeted tissue of a subject between a distal surface of the primary button and a proximal surface of the secondary button upon application of a tension to one or both of the first suture strand and the second suture strand.

2 . The suture-button system of claim 1 , wherein the first set of primary apertures and the second set of primary apertures are disposed symmetrical to each other on the primary button.

3 . The suture-button system of claim 1 , wherein the primary button comprises a primary threaded portion for receiving a secondary threaded portion of a lock, so as to removably couple the lock to the primary button, such that one or both of the first suture strand and the second suture strand are prevented from translating through the respective primary apertures and thereby securing the clamping of the targeted tissue.

4 . The suture-button system of claim 3 , wherein the primary threaded portion comprises a female threaded portion.

5 . The suture-button system of claim 3 , wherein the lock comprises a head and wherein the secondary threaded portion extends from the head.

6 . The suture-button system of claim 5 , wherein a distal surface of the head is tapered outwards from a center axis of the lock.

7 . The suture-button system of claim 3 , wherein the lock comprises a driver feature, an alignment feature, or both.

8 . The suture-button system of claim 7 , wherein the driver feature and the alignment feature are generally concentric.

9 . The suture-button system of claim 1 , wherein a distal surface of the secondary button comprises a channel connecting two or more of the plurality of secondary apertures.
